2008/5/23 Emery Guevremont <emery.guevremont@gmail.com>:
> Another option could be to buy a usb-rs232 adapter. It's easy to install
> and it's cheap. A recent kernel should support it and once plugged in a
> usb port, udev will create the device /dev/ttyUSB0.
You'd have to be careful with this, see below:
-- LIRC FAQ http://www.lirc.org/faq.html --
5. Can I use a home-brew LIRC receiver with a Serial to USB adapter?
No, this won't work. But there is a project working on a dedicated USB
transceiver. Using an Irman with USB adapter should work though.
